Keycard Entry Systems
Keycard access systems have become a popular choice for businesses seeking to improve their security. These systems let you oversee who enters your premises easily and efficiently. By providing keycards to employees, you can manage access to designated sections, ensuring that only authorized personnel can enter sensitive locations.
Keycards can be programmed to limit access based on roles, times, or locations, offering you versatile management capabilities. Furthermore, should a card be misplaced or taken, you can quickly deactivate it, reducing the risk of unauthorized entry.
With user-friendly interfaces and integration options, keycard systems streamline your security procedures. By selecting this solution, you're taking a significant step toward securing your assets while maintaining convenience for your staff.
Biometric Verification Techniques
As you evaluate various access control systems, think about biometric authentication approaches, which present a high level of security for businesses. These systems utilize unique physical characteristics, such as fingerprints, facial recognition, or iris scans, to validate identities. By deploying biometric authentication, you reduce the risk of unauthorized access since it's nearly impossible to replicate these traits. This method not only strengthens security but also simplifies the access process, enabling employees rapid entry without requiring physical cards or codes. Plus, biometric data is usually encrypted, creating another layer of protection. Implementing this technology can considerably safeguard your assets, guaranteeing that only authorized personnel can access restricted areas of your business. On-the-Go Access Solutions
With the advancement of mobile technology, businesses are continually implementing mobile access solutions to upgrade their access control systems. These solutions enable you to manage access through smartphones, tablets, or other mobile devices, making it easier for employees to enter secure areas without traditional keycards or fobs. You can provide or remove access remotely, ensuring that only authorized personnel can enter sensitive areas. Mobile access solutions typically use encryption and multifactor authentication, adding extra layers of security. Additionally, they streamline operations by integrating with existing systems, minimizing the need for on-site personnel. What Investment Is Required for Access Control System Installation?
Setting up access control systems involves costs for hardware, software, installation, routine maintenance, and employee training. You must also budget for potential upgrades and system integration, which can expand your total investment.
How Often Should Access Control Systems Be Updated?
You need to update access control systems at least annually or whenever there are significant changes in staff, technology, or security risks. Frequent updates guarantee your system maintains its effectiveness and safeguards your resources from potential security gaps.
